Is it safer to be in middle or back of the plane

According to a TIME investigation from 2015 that examined 35 years of aircraft accident data, the middle seats at the back of the plane had the lowest fatality rate at 28%. The second-safest option is the aisle seats in the middle of the plane, at 44%.

Which seat is most stable in airplane

“The smoothest place to sit is over the wings,” commercial pilot Patrick Smith, host of AskThePilot.com said. These seats are close to the plane's center of lift and gravity. “The roughest spot is usually the far aft. In the rearmost rows, closest to the tail, the knocking and swaying is more pronounced,” Smith added.

What is the safest seat to survive a plane crash

Middle seats at the back of the plane had the lowest fatality rates. Survivors who are near an exit are more likely to get out alive following a crash, a 2008 study from the University of Greenwich found.
